Bolder Band - I have used the regular elastic bands before, but they always either felt like they were going to slip out of place or they did. I ran across these bands online and ordered one. I used it today when I walked/ran for 60 minutes on the treadmill. It NEVER slipped. It stayed in place and was super comfortable. It even soaked up the sweat by my hairline. I didn't have to wipe my face on and off for the entire workout. It was drenched when I took it off, but luckily I can just throw it in the washer! Polar FT4 HRM - Someone suggested that I get a heart rate monitor to give me more accurate information for my workouts. I also like it because I will have correct information when we take the dogs for a walk. I'm going to connect it to Endomondo.com this weekend. I used it during my hour workout today and it showed that I burned 39 more calories than the treadmill showed. I found this one cheapest on Rakuten.com for $63.

Today starts my new weight loss challenge. I started late last month and was basically maintaining my weight after I lost some water weight. I got discouraged and took a break for a week. Now I am back at it and just starting fresh. My goals this time around are to get at least 30 minutes of cardio done in the morning and then do strength exercises on the Bowflex and crunches at night. I also want to eat NO MORE than 1200 calories a day. I want to lose about 3 pounds a week.

Today I started the C25K program for the 2nd time. I tried it years ago and never made it past week 3 due to my knees. I hope this time around I am able to make it to the end. I can't say that at this moment I actually want to run a 5K. It would be nice to be able to do it though. You never know...I may change my mind.
